Recognise and use repeated reasoning to generalise: extend patterns in equivalent fractions and percentage conversions, derive unknown facts from known facts, describe general rules for sequences and predict terms
What mastery looks like
- Notice that multiplying any number by 25 can be done by multiplying by 100 then dividing by 4, and explain why
- Describe the general rule for a sequence and predict the 20th term
- Generalise: to find 10% divide by 10, to find 5% halve 10%, and use this to find 35% of any number
